Takara Leben LEBEN NIGHT GAME

On June 1, 2023, Takara Leben held its first endowed game in four years since 2019, the Takara Leben LEBEN NIGHT GAME (Tohoku Rakuten Golden Eagles vs. Yokohama DeNA BayStars).

The Tohoku Rakuten Golden Eagles was established in 2005 as the only professional baseball team in the Tohoku region after 50 years. The team has built its roots in Tohoku by hosting games in each Tohoku prefecture and donating sports facilities to the areas affected by the Great East Japan Earthquake. The team won the league championship and Japan No. 1 title in 2013.

We have sponsored a game every year with the aim of becoming a company that is loved by the local community like the Tohoku Rakuten Golden Eagles since our expansion into the Tohoku area in 2014. We have not been able to host a crowned game for the past three years due to the spread of coronavirus, but in 2023, we were able to do so for the first time in four years. We will be wishing for the victory of Tohoku Rakuten Golden Eagles from here on out and contributing to the revitalization of the Tohoku area as a company.

Donation of soccer balls to elementary and junior high schools in Toyama Prefecture

Takara Leben is a sponsor of KATALLER TOYAMA soccer club team, which participates in the J-League. In November 2023, together with other sponsors, we donated soccer balls to elementary and junior high schools at the Special Room in Toyama Prefectural Government.

Since 2009, we have supplied 13 projects in Toyama Prefecture, contributing to urban development and community revitalization. Since 2013, we have continued to support " KATALLER TOYAMA" as a sponsor, aiming to contribute to the sound upbringing of youth, the promotion of sports, and the revitalization of the local community.

Takara Leben supports KATALLER TOYAMA by donating soccer balls to elementary and junior high schools in Toyama Prefecture, with the aim of contributing to the sound upbringing of children, the local community, and the development of youth.

Nippon TV Tokyo Verdy Beleza

Since February 2021, MIRARTH HOLDINGS has entered into a corporate partner agreement with Nippon TV Tokyo Verdy Beleza, Japan's leading women's soccer team, to deliver the excitement and joy of sports to the public. Through sponsorship of this team, we will support the success of women and contribute to Itabashi-ku and Kita-ku, Tokyo, where our company was founded.

Kishu Kuchikumano Marathon 2024

MIRARTH Asset Management (formerly Takara Asset Management) is an official sponsor of the Kishu Kuchikumano Marathon. This is a full and half marathon featuring a course rich in nature, held on the first Sunday of February every year in Kamitonda-cho, Wakayama Prefecture. The LS Shirahama Power Plant, which the company manages under asset management, is in the same town. So, the company is working to contribute to society and revitalize the local community through sponsorship of the event.

SDGs QUEST Mirai Koshien

MIRARTH HOLDINGS officially sponsored the "SDGs QUEST Mirai Koshien" 2023.

This is a competition for high school students to explore the SDGs (Sustainable Development Goals), present their ideas and action plans for solving social issues in order to think and act for a sustainable future for the earth.

The "2030 Inquiry Newspaper" introduces the action ideas of the top and excellent prize-winning teams from the competitions held in each area in 2022. Additionally, in August 2023, an online national exchange meeting was held as a platform for the teams that won the top prizes in the competitions held in 11 regions across the country in 2022 to interact and exchange ideas. As a corporate award, we presented the MIRARTH Prize to the "Muroyowashi" team from Hokkaido Iwamizawa Agricultural High School for their action plan titled "Transforming Heavy Snow Areas and Rice Husks into Zero-Carbon Agricultural Production Areas. This initiative started in Hokkaido and Kansai in 2019, and the number of areas and participants is continuing to grow each year.

The competition will be held in 32 prefectures in 19 areas having approximately 4,800 high schools joining throughout Japan for FY2023.

Mt. Fuji Asagiri Biomass Power Plant Tour

In August 2023, MIRARTH HOLDINGS invited the Hokkaido Iwamizawa Agricultural High School "Muroyowashi" team to visit the Group's Mt. Fuji Asagiri Biomass Power Plant in Fujinomiya City, Shizuoka Prefecture. The team won the top prize at the Hokkaido Area Competition and the MIRARTH Award at the national exchange meeting for their action plan, "Toward a Zero Carbon Agriculture Production Region Using Snow and Rice Husks in Heavy Snowfall Areas," at the 2022 SDGs QUEST Mirai Koshien.

This power plant not only reuses facilities that were used as part of the "Eco-Harmonized Biomass Resource Utilization Model Project" by the Ministry of the Environment, but also expands the facilities to increase the amount of cattle manure that becomes industrial waste, thereby strengthening efforts to solve local issues. We are also expanding storage tanks and other facilities so that the liquid fertilizer produced in the project can be applied at the appropriate time and are further improving the facility to contribute to the local community.

During the tour, in addition to the explanation of the current situation and equipment in the power plant as described above, the participants also observed how cow manure is received from nearby dairy farmers. The participating high school students commented, "It was good to see an example of natural energy utilization like the action plan we came up with," "I would like to make use of what I have learned in my future student life, " and "I was able to realize that the cycle of solving local issues is circulating."

Ehime SDGs Koshien

Takara Leben and Leben Community were special sponsors of the "Ehime SDGs Koshien: High School Students' SDGs Practice Project.”

The competition is intended to be a practical project where high school students can interact with the community and their peers, improve their communication skills, and acquire the ability to think with respect for diverse values and the environment as a place to practice ESD (Education for Sustainable Development). This is a project commemorating the 50th anniversary of the company's founding and was planned and developed jointly with RES, a non-profit organization, in 2022.

A total of 303 students from 51 teams from high schools throughout Ehime Prefecture participated in the 2023 tournament. In the preliminary round held in August, each team decided on an issue or theme that they wanted to solve in their local community or their own living environment to achieve the SDGs17. The judging was based on the activities conducted in response to these challenges and a video summarizing the results of these activities. 12 teams, 79 people in total, won the preliminary round. In the finals, the 12 winning teams from the preliminary round gave 10-minute presentations, and the team with the highest overall score was selected as the grand prix winner and awarded the prize. In addition, Takara Leben awarded the "Takara Leben Award" to "Team COSMOS" from Kita-Uwa High School's Mima Branch for their "#Mima Project: Energize the Town with the Power of High School Students. " We evaluated not only their ability to conceptualize a rice burger using local specialty rice, but their high level of execution to actually sell the product to revitalize a depopulated local community.

We will continue to create opportunities for young people leading the next generation, to research local issues to achieve the SDGs and acquire the ability to discover issues and take action to solve them, to develop "creators of a sustainable society" as stated in the official guidelines for school teaching.

Sponsorship of "Osaka Healthcare Pavilion" at Expo 2025 Osaka, Kansai, Japan

MIRARTH HOLDINGS Group is an official partner of the Osaka Health Care Pavilion at the Expo 2025 Osaka, Kansai, Japan.

The Osaka-Kansai Expo is an international exposition to be held in Yumeshima, Osaka City, under the theme of "Designing Future Society for Our Lives. " This will be Japan's sixth World Expo and will bring together wisdom from around the world to address a variety of global issues. The Expo site will feature pavilions and events introducing cultures and technologies from around the world, as well as exhibits and hands-on programs that will offer visitors an opportunity to think about future society.

Through its sponsorship, the Company will support the success of this event.

Environment Photo Contest

MIRARTH HOLDINGS participated in the 30th Environmental Photo Contest 2024 (sponsored by President Inc. and supported by the Ministry of the Environment and the Institute for Environmental Civilization), in which citizens took photos based on a theme set by companies and express their thoughts and commitment to the environment through joint efforts by companies and citizens. The MIRARTH HOLDINGS Award, which was given under the theme of "Happiness of People and the Earth," attracted 845 entries that captured moments of Earth teeming with life and irreplaceable "happiness."

After a rigorous screening process, we awarded the Excellence Award to "Whether the puddle looks beautiful or not depends on ..."

MOMAT Corporate Partnership

The National Museum of Modern Art, Tokyo, a central center for art in Japan, is promoting MOMAT Support Circle, a new museum support system in which companies and museums work as partners.

Takara Leben has been a partner company of the MOMAT Support Circle since July 2021 and continued to support the activities of the National Museum of Modern Art, Tokyo (including exhibition organization, research and surveys, collection and storage of artworks, educational outreach activities, and museum management projects) in 2023. By supporting the activities of the National Museum of Modern Art, Tokyo, we contribute to fostering culture and provide opportunities for employees to experience outstanding works of art.
